Bug description:
  Architecture: 64 bit
  Operating System: Arch Linux
  Version of Openshot installed: 1.4.3
  MLT/melt version: 0.9.0-1
  FFmpeg ersion: 1:1.2.1-1    

  As the title says, I can't add images to the timeline. When dragging an image to the timeline, I get two " + " (yellow and green) and when image is dropped to the timeline, the image is "tiny". Image properties showed me that the length is only 0,03 seconds. 
  I also checked the length in "Settings" and it says "length of the imported images 7,00". Adding an image directly from the "Project files" makes no difference.

  Anyway, no problems with previewing images or video files. Adding
  video files to the timeline works OK.

  When "New title" is successfuly generated, it does not show in
  "Project files".
